What Are Weight Benches and How Do They Enhance Your Workout Experience?
Weight benches are essential equipment in strength training that provide a stable surface for performing various exercises, enhancing your workout experience significantly.
- Flat Weight Bench: A flat weight bench offers a straightforward design where the bench is level, allowing for exercises such as bench presses and dumbbell workouts. Its simplicity makes it versatile for a variety of lifting routines, accommodating both beginners and advanced lifters.
- Adjustable Weight Bench: This type of bench can be modified to different angles, including incline and decline positions, which helps target various muscle groups more effectively. The ability to adjust the angle adds versatility to workouts, enabling exercises like incline presses or decline flys that engage different parts of the chest and shoulders.
- Incline Weight Bench: Specifically designed to be set at an angle, incline benches are particularly effective for exercises that focus on the upper chest and shoulders. This position enhances muscle activation in these areas and allows for a greater range of motion compared to flat bench exercises.
- Decline Weight Bench: The decline bench is angled downward, allowing for exercises that target the lower chest more effectively. This bench is especially beneficial for movements such as decline presses and sit-ups, which can help in building core strength and muscle definition.
- Multi-Purpose Weight Bench: These benches combine features of flat, adjustable, incline, and decline benches, offering a wide range of exercise possibilities. They are ideal for home gyms where space is limited, as they allow users to perform an extensive variety of lifts and workouts without needing multiple pieces of equipment.
- Weight Bench with Rack: This bench comes with an integrated rack for holding barbells, making it convenient for exercises like bench presses without the need for a separate setup. Having the rack built-in enhances safety and efficiency, allowing users to easily lift weights and perform exercises without needing a spotter.

How Do Flat Weight Benches Differ from Adjustable Weight Benches?
Flat weight benches and adjustable weight benches serve different purposes in strength training, impacting versatility and exercise options.
- Flat Weight Benches: These benches are designed with a fixed, horizontal surface and are primarily used for exercises like bench presses and dumbbell work that require a stable platform.
- Adjustable Weight Benches: These benches can be altered to various angles, allowing for incline and decline positions, which expands the range of exercises that can be performed.
Flat weight benches are straightforward in design, providing a solid and stable base that is ideal for traditional bench press movements. Their simplicity makes them a staple in many gyms, as they are easy to use and require no adjustments, allowing for quick transitions between exercises.
Adjustable weight benches, on the other hand, offer more versatility by allowing users to change the angle of the bench to suit different exercises. This feature enables users to perform a wider variety of movements, targeting different muscle groups effectively, and is particularly beneficial for exercises like incline presses or seated shoulder presses.
What Key Features Should You Consider When Choosing a Weight Bench?
When choosing a weight bench, several key features should be considered to ensure it meets your workout needs and safety requirements.
- Adjustability: A good weight bench should offer various adjustments, including incline, decline, and flat positions. This versatility allows users to target different muscle groups effectively and perform a wider range of exercises.
- Weight Capacity: It’s crucial to check the weight capacity of the bench, as this determines how much weight you can safely lift. A bench with a higher weight capacity is more durable and suitable for users with heavier lifting requirements.
- Stability: Stability is essential for safety during workouts, particularly when lifting heavy weights. A bench with a robust frame and non-slip feet will provide a solid foundation, reducing the risk of tipping or wobbling during use.
- Padding and Comfort: The quality of padding affects comfort during workouts, especially during extended sessions. Look for benches with thick, durable foam padding that offers support without compromising stability.
- Portability: If you have limited space or plan to move your bench frequently, consider its weight and whether it has wheels for easy transport. A foldable design can also save space when not in use.
- Material Quality: The materials used in the construction of the weight bench play a significant role in its longevity and performance. Choose benches made from high-quality steel and durable upholstery to withstand regular use.
- Safety Features: Some benches come with added safety features, like locking mechanisms or spotter arms. These features can enhance the safety of your workouts, especially when lifting alone.

What Are the Pros and Cons of Various Weight Benches?
| Weight Bench Type |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|
| Flat Bench | Simple design, great for basic lifts, ideal for bench press. | Limited versatility, no incline or decline options, may not target all muscle groups. |
| Adjustable Bench | Versatile for different exercises, multiple angles, better for overall chest development. | Can be more expensive, may require more space, potential stability issues if not locked properly. |
| Decline Bench | Targets lower chest effectively, good for specific workouts, allows for decline sit-ups. | Less common, may not fit all exercise routines, limited use for upper chest exercises. |
| Weight Bench with Rack | Integrated safety for heavy lifts, multifunctional, great for heavy bench press and squats. | Size and weight may be an issue for home gyms, can be cumbersome to move. |
